Definitions and Meaning of foible in English
foible (n)
a behavioral attribute that is distinctive and peculiar to an individual
the weaker part of a sword's blade from the forte to the tip
foible (a.)
Weak; feeble.
foible (n.)
A moral weakness; a failing; a weak point; a frailty.
The half of a sword blade or foil blade nearest the point; -- opposed to forte.
